apache-kafka - 安装 Kafka 2.7.0 并出现此错误:无法找到或加载主类 org.apache.zookeeper.server.quorum.QuorumPeerMain
问题描述
我正在尝试在 Windows 10 中安装 Kafka 2.7.0。我一直在关注课程中的链接并从https://mirrors.estointernet.in/apache/kafka/2.7.0/kafka-2.7.0下载了一个 tar 文件-src.tgz 解压后,我尝试运行以下命令,这给了我标题中提到的错误。
zookeeper-server-start.bat config/zookeeper.properties
我没有从下载的 Kafka tar 文件中获得任何 zookeeper tar 文件。任何帮助表示赞赏。发行日期为 2021 年 1 月 30 日。
解决方案
您已经下载了 Kafka 源代码,而不是 Kafka 二进制文件,因此那里没有可运行的构建类
您还应该使用 WSL2 中的 shell 脚本而不是 CMD 中的批处理文件
https://www.confluent.io/blog/set-up-and-run-kafka-on-windows-linux-wsl-2/
推荐阅读
- bash - macos bash 似乎忽略了 elif 并且只有第一个 if 语句按预期工作
- python - 使用请求模块发布数据时,在 Mod_Security 请求错误上出现 403 被禁止
- python - 如何在我的请求 Django 中从模板发送数据
- javascript - 如何创建不可变数组?
- reactjs - CORS 在开发机器上发出带有 HTTP 触发器的 Azure Functions
- mysql - 在运行时从 spring 连接 MySql 数据库
- linux - windows子系统Linux在终端找不到文件
- javascript - 如何在具有相似值但不同的数组中循环值?
- android - 每次连接后如何解决Android旋转BLE Mac地址的问题?
- java - 使用java 8按类型列表的对象属性对对象列表进行分组:JAVA